- | === 3-wire PNP sensor connection example | + | ==== ET10 Encoder inputs ==== |
- | < | + | ET10 board has 6 Incremental encoder inputs. There are 4 complete ABC encoder inputs (A/B quadrature encoder signals and Z signal) and 2 reduced AB encoder inputs. ET10 encoder inputs conform RS422 standard and compatible with most of the servo drivers and line driver incremental encoders. 34C86 chip is used in ET10 as a receiver of encoder signals. Internal schematic for line driver encoder inputs is shown on a picture below. |

+ | ==== ET10 DAC +/-10V DAC outputs ==== | ||
- | === Switch connection example === | + | ET10 control board contains 6 channel +/-10V DAC outputs. This outputs can be used for analogue servo drivers closed-loop control, spindle speed control or any other application that needed in analogue signals in +/-10V range. |
